Common Welding Problems



Several usual welding problems can compromise the honesty of bonded frameworks, causing prospective failings if not dealt with. Amongst these issues, porosity is just one of one of the most common, characterized by the visibility of little gas pockets caught within the weld metal. This can dramatically damage the joint, causing lowered structural stability.




Another problem is insufficient combination, which takes place when the weld metal stops working to adequately fuse with the base material or previous weld layers. This lack of bonding can develop weak points that may fail under tension. Likewise, absence of penetration describes insufficient deepness of weld metal, preventing the joint from accomplishing its designated toughness.


Fractures can likewise develop during the welding process, typically as a result of rapid air conditioning or unsuitable welding specifications. These cracks may circulate under load, causing devastating failures. In addition, excessive spatter can prevent the weld's top quality by introducing contaminants.


Assessment Approaches and methods



Effective inspection strategies and methods are important for guaranteeing the integrity and durability of welded frameworks. A thorough evaluation routine employs a selection of non-destructive testing (NDT) methods to identify prospective defects without endangering the welded parts. Among one of the most frequently made use of strategies are visual examination, ultrasonic testing, radiographic screening, magnetic address particle screening, and dye penetrant testing.


Visual assessment functions as the initial line of defense, enabling inspectors to recognize surface area flaws such as splits, imbalances, or insufficient blend. Ultrasonic screening utilizes high-frequency acoustic waves to identify interior imperfections, offering thorough info about the material's stability. Radiographic screening employs X-rays or gamma rays to picture the inner framework of welds, enabling the identification of additions and gaps.


Magnetic particle testing is effective for detecting surface and near-surface stoppages in ferromagnetic materials, while dye penetrant screening highlights surface-breaking issues utilizing colored dyes. Each method has its special benefits and constraints, necessitating a calculated mix to accomplish thorough evaluation protection. Applying these strategies methodically ensures that any potential concerns are determined early, promoting the dependability and durability of bonded structures.
